What is the American Society on Aging?

The American Society on Aging unites, empowers and champions everyone striving to improve aging. Since 1954, ASA has developed and led the largest, most diverse community of professionals working in aging in America.

Herein, does America have an aging population?

The number of Americans ages 65 and older will more than double over the next 40 years, reaching 80 million in 2040. The nation is aging. … By 2040, about one in five Americans will be age 65 or older, up from about one in eight in 2000.
